Yann Diomande Real Madrid transfer gathers momentum
The Yann Diomande Real Madrid transfer is approaching its final stages, with the Spanish giants reportedly closing in on a deal worth €120 million, including bonuses. After seeing an initial bid rejected, Real Madrid have returned with an improved offer that appears to have convinced RB Leipzig to continue negotiations.
The 19-year-old Ivorian talent has already approved the move, making the Santiago Bernabeu his preferred destination as he prepares for what could become one of the biggest transfers of the summer.
Madrid increase their offer
According to transfer specialists at Foot Mercato, Real Madrid’s first proposal of €100 million was turned down by Leipzig. However, discussions between the two clubs have progressed significantly after the Spanish side returned with a package valued at around €120 million, including performance-related bonuses.
Club representatives are now working to finalize the remaining details, with optimism growing that an agreement will soon be reached.
Transfer expert Ben Jacobs also reported that Madrid have intensified talks in recent days and are increasingly confident of securing the highly-rated winger.
Mourinho identifies Diomande as a priority
Real Madrid manager Jose Mourinho is believed to have requested the signing of a fast and versatile attacker capable of stretching opposing defenses.
Diomande perfectly fits that profile. Comfortable on either wing, the teenager combines explosive pace with excellent dribbling ability and the versatility to operate across the attacking line. Madrid’s coaching staff reportedly view him as a player capable of adding a new dimension to the team’s offensive play.
His age also aligns with the club’s long-term strategy of investing in elite young talent who could become future stars.
PSG withdraw from the race
Before Madrid emerged as favourites, Paris Saint-Germain appeared to be leading the race for Diomande’s signature.
The French champions had reportedly reached a preliminary agreement with the player, but negotiations with Leipzig eventually stalled. The German club insisted on receiving between €120 million and €130 million, while also requesting that Diomande remain on loan for another season.
PSG ultimately decided those conditions were too demanding and withdrew from negotiations rather than commit to such an expensive deal.
Real Madrid seize the opportunity
The collapse of PSG’s negotiations opened the door for Madrid to act decisively. While much of the media attention focused on links with Michael Olise of Bayern Munich, the Spanish giants quietly accelerated discussions with Leipzig behind the scenes.
That strategy now appears to be paying off, with the Yann Diomande Real Madrid transfer moving closer to completion. If the final agreement is signed, Madrid will secure one of Europe’s most promising young attackers and further strengthen a squad already filled with emerging talent ahead of the new season.
